Abstract

The invention discloses a solar ground source heat pump heat supply and air conditioning system design method, and belongs to the technical field of heat supply system design. The method comprises thefollowing steps: 1) selecting a reasonable air conditioner design scheme according to meteorological parameters of a construction area and construction building characteristics; 2) analyzing the heattransfer process of the underground buried pipe heat exchanger, selecting a proper heat pump unit according to the heat load, and determining the design scheme of the buried pipe; 3) calculating theheat which needs to be compensated for when the annual buried pipe heat exchanger reaches heat balance, and designing a solar heat collection system. Solar energy is adopted as an auxiliary heat source, so that the heat pump system can be designed according to summer working conditions, the solar heat collector bears a part of heat load, the initial cost of a ground source part is reduced, rich solar energy resources can be fully utilized, and the use cost is reduced.

Description

technical field [0001] The invention belongs to the technical field of heat supply system design, and in particular relates to a design method of a solar ground source heat pump heat supply and air conditioning system. Background technique [0002] In northern China, the heat load of buildings in winter is relatively large, so the system design is mainly based on heat load. If the ground source heat pump is completely used for heating, the initial investment of the geothermal heat exchanger and the unit is relatively high, and the efficiency of continuous operation is also low. When running in summer, the capacity of the unit is too large, resulting in waste. Moreover, since these areas take more heat from the ground in winter than heat stored in the ground in summer, long-term operation will cause the temperature of the ground to drop, and the COP value of the heat pump system will also be relatively low.
